Transaction 5c489cf77cbb8ae8ccdada25991f85e6c09356ec83c58bff40d86f596a63fc45

1 Input
2 Outputs
  • 5c489cf77cbb8ae8ccdada25991f85e6c09356ec83c58bff40d86f596a63fc45:0
  • value  25796773
    address  123FWtsE7Sk2xWLGTpZEf8p226kSuiVBBk
  • 5c489cf77cbb8ae8ccdada25991f85e6c09356ec83c58bff40d86f596a63fc45:1
  • value  7848344
    address  18hm1Eu7iaGjvAqFaoPKTi2fdg6hWdCtN8